Commissioning and first operation experience of the CMS RPC Detector Control System at LHC.
The CMS Resistive Plate Chambers (RPC) system consists of 912 double-gap chambers. The challenging constrains on the design and operation of this system imposed the development of a complex Detector Control System to assure the operational stability and reliability of a so large and complex detecto...
